there is already a system in place where you can look for partys currently going on.

if you look under the character information window their is a booking tab that lists all current parties. And if you go looking for a party just use /recruit select what classes you would like to group with, select the map, select the level range and click ok and your party shows up under the booking tab. You will usually get parties easier if you create a booking as I have found the booking system to be extremely helpful when looking for a group.
